首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我是否可以更改PR上的简单select查询的结果块大小

PR是指Pull Request,是一种代码审查和合并的机制,常用于开发团队中进行代码协作和版本控制。在PR上进行简单select查询的结果块大小的更改,涉及到数据库查询优化的问题。

在数据库中,查询结果块大小(Block Size)是指在执行查询操作时,数据库引擎从磁盘读取数据的最小单位。更改查询结果块大小可以影响查询性能和资源利用效率。

一般来说,较大的查询结果块大小可以提高查询性能,因为每次读取的数据量增加,减少了磁盘IO的次数。但是,过大的查询结果块大小可能会导致内存占用过高,影响系统的稳定性和并发性能。

在调整查询结果块大小时,需要综合考虑以下几个因素:

  1. 数据库引擎的支持:不同的数据库引擎对查询结果块大小的支持可能有所不同。可以查阅数据库引擎的官方文档或者参考相关资料,了解具体的设置方法和参数。
  2. 数据库的硬件资源:查询结果块大小的设置需要考虑数据库所在服务器的硬件资源情况,包括内存大小、磁盘IO性能等。合理设置查询结果块大小可以充分利用硬件资源,提高查询效率。
  3. 查询的数据量和复杂度:查询结果块大小的设置也需要考虑查询的数据量和复杂度。对于大数据量的查询,适当增大查询结果块大小可以减少磁盘IO次数,提高查询速度。但是对于复杂的查询,过大的查询结果块大小可能会导致内存占用过高,影响系统性能。
  4. 系统的负载情况:在调整查询结果块大小时,还需要考虑系统的负载情况。如果系统同时有其他高负载的任务,适当减小查询结果块大小可以降低对系统资源的竞争,保证系统的稳定性和并发性能。

在腾讯云的产品中,可以使用腾讯云数据库(TencentDB)来进行数据库查询结果块大小的设置。具体的设置方法和参数可以参考腾讯云数据库的官方文档:TencentDB产品介绍

需要注意的是,以上答案仅供参考,具体的查询结果块大小的设置还需要根据实际情况进行调整和测试。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券